encore
US /ˈɑːŋ.kɔːr/
UK /ˈɑːŋ.kɔːr/

1.
encore, tambahan
a repeated or additional performance of an item at the end of a concert, as called for by an audience.
:
•
The band played an encore after the enthusiastic applause.
Band itu memainkan encore setelah tepuk tangan meriah.
•
The audience demanded an encore, chanting for more.
Penonton menuntut encore, meneriakkan minta lagi.
